CRM Stroyprofit

Alexander Musikhin 879c057749 disk spase monitoring 12 часов назад
.claude 5b575cbae6 1. Карточка запчасти (spare_parts/edit.blade.php) 3 месяцев назад
app 879c057749 disk spase monitoring 12 часов назад
bootstrap c0da737d0d fix: fcm fo apple, add fcm logging 2 месяцев назад
config 879c057749 disk spase monitoring 12 часов назад
database d2c1274b1d delete old generated files and import files by scheduler 12 часов назад
docker 5ba7a6629c Update mobile UI and local environment config 1 месяц назад
docs ac55b4fa51 Add contractors and installation specifications 2 недель назад
lang 4859a8047f fix mobile 2 месяцев назад
public f36f648997 added product images 1 месяц назад
resources 879c057749 disk spase monitoring 12 часов назад
routes d2c1274b1d delete old generated files and import files by scheduler 12 часов назад
storage 55e949511d upd gitignore 1 год назад
templates 01459b0c46 fix specification 1 день назад
tests 879c057749 disk spase monitoring 12 часов назад
.ai-factory.json 39881994b6 tests for jobs, settings for tests, agents and mcp 2 месяцев назад
.env.example 879c057749 disk spase monitoring 12 часов назад
.env.testing 5ba7a6629c Update mobile UI and local environment config 1 месяц назад
.gitattributes 7a26cd566d initial commit 1 год назад
.gitignore d68a8da84b add .DS_Store to gitignore 1 месяц назад
AGENTS.md 935026429e Fix spare part order stock receipt action 3 недель назад
Dockerfile a55bc00ef6 Add scheduled database backups with rotation 1 месяц назад
Makefile 119ed5521d fix test clear db 3 недель назад
README.md 6ac3b99f38 test 1 год назад
SPARE_PARTS_ENHANCEMENTS.md cd1dec2c7a Добавлены улучшения модуля запчастей: фильтры, справочник расценок, автозаполнение 3 месяцев назад
SPARE_PARTS_MODULE.md 7014bb8066 fix filters 3 месяцев назад
artisan 7a26cd566d initial commit 1 год назад
bpmn.drawio 3bd72bb325 added quantity of added products to order 1 год назад
composer.json c0da737d0d fix: fcm fo apple, add fcm logging 2 месяцев назад
composer.lock ff64eaab9c test fcm notifications 7 месяцев назад
docker-compose.debug.yml 5ba7a6629c Update mobile UI and local environment config 1 месяц назад
docker-compose.yml a55bc00ef6 Add scheduled database backups with rotation 1 месяц назад
package-lock.json 4a9d182fd8 replace external Google Fonts with local @fontsource Nunito 1 месяц назад
package.json 4a9d182fd8 replace external Google Fonts with local @fontsource Nunito 1 месяц назад
phpunit.xml 5c90c21962 auth tests 2 месяцев назад
postcss.config.js 7a26cd566d initial commit 1 год назад
tailwind.config.js 7a26cd566d initial commit 1 год назад
todo.md 30f9cec623 added firebase packages 7 месяцев назад
u 941485a38d added update script 2 месяцев назад
vite.config.js 345bb6792a Changed ports 1 год назад

README.md

CRM stroyprofit

Основные задачи:

  • каталог товаров
  • учет остатков товаров
  • ведение заказов клиентов
  • заказы поставщикам
  • работа с рекламациями
  • формирование пакетов документов для монтажа, сдачи, отработки рекламации итп

Для развертывания приложения нужно:

  • git clone ... appFolder
  • cd appFolder
  • cp .env.example .env
  • edit .env
  • make install

Для работы необходим установленный docker, docker-compose

Фронтэнд приложения: bootstrap 5, js, jquery

Бэкенд приложения: laravel 11, php 8.2 (fpm mode)

Для обратной связи с клиентом используется websocket

Имеется обработчик очереди задач

Кеш и очередь - redis